WRY-16 (98), RRY-16 (98) (CONTEC) Mercury / reed relay contact output module.WRY-16 (98) is a mercury relay, RRY-16 (98) mounts regular reed relays respectively.16 output signals in total Contact, positive logic.The next instruction is executed for the signal output to the output port Keep that state until.All outputs are OFF (break) at power on It becomes a state.WRY-16 (98) has conditions in the mounting direction, so it is made of CONTEC Use within the I / O expansion unit "FA-PAC (98)". There are two 8-deep dip switches on the board. ■ WRY-16 (98) specifications Contact rating (MAX): switching capacity = 50 W, switching voltage = 500 V DC, switching current = 1 A Contact resistance = 100mΩ or less Operating time = 3 ms or less Recovery time = 2 ms or less Power supply capacity = +5 V, 1.5 mA Operating condition = 0 to 50 °, 20 to 90% (no condensation) Response time = Within 3 ms after instruction execution Used relay = NEC UMD1A-05 ■ RRY-16 (98) specifications Contact rating (MAX): switching capacity = 5 W, switching voltage = DC 50 V, switching current = 100 mA, Energized current = 200mA Contact resistance = 150mΩ or less Operating time = 0.1 to 0.3 ms Recovery time = 0.1 ms or less Power supply capacity = +5 V, 500 mA Operating condition = 0 to 50 °, 20 to 90% (no condensation) Response time = within 0.5 ms after instruction execution Used relay = NEC PG1A-05 ・ 8-station dip switches SW1 and SW2: I / O port address setting Each dip of each switch corresponds to ON and OFF to 0 respectively.Therefore For example, when setting to F0D0h, 1-2-3-4-5-6-7-8 of each switch is SW1: 1-1-1-0-0-0-0 SW2: 1-0-1-0-0-0-0 Set toAs a rule, specify the lower 2 digit port numbers D0 to DFh. Note: 8 of SW2 is invalid (divided into 2 pairs of ports in this I / F board) The correspondence between output port address and data is as follows: -Configured port address + 0 For D7-D6-D5-D4-D3-D2-D1-D0, O7-O6-O5-O4-O3-O2-O1-O0 -Configured port address + 1 O15-O14-O13-O12-O11-O10-O9-O8 against D7-D6-D5-D4-D3-D2-D1-D0 The LEDs on the board are O0, O1, O2 ... from the bottom when the card edge is seen to the right.
